The Orion Township Fire Department is an all-hazards Fire Department that provides fire protection and Advanced Life Support (ALS) emergency medical services to the residents, businesses, and visitors of both Orion Township and The Village of Lake Orion.

In response to the potential for rapidly changing conditions associated with the water main leak in Auburn Hills, Orion Township has declared a state of emergency. This proactive step allows the Township to secure county and state support resources if needed.

At present, Great Lakes Water Authority (GLWA) maintains that the leak remains stable and residents are still encouraged to use water as normal. However, in the case of a water main break, Orion Township is expecting to experience a water outage for up to several days.

If this should occur, coordinated emergency measures to support community health and safety will be implemented, including multiple emergency water stations and assistance for vulnerable populations.
